2

Я пытаюсь использовать командное окно Matlab из Emacs.

Я набрал M-! чтобы получить приглашение для команды оболочки, я набрал matlab , и, как и ожидалось, окно командной строки Matlab открылось внутри emacs, как показано на следующем рисунке:

альтернативный текст

Проблема в том, что при попытке ввода команд ничего не происходит. Более конкретно, то, что я печатаю, появляется там (на рисунке вы можете видеть, что я набрал "demo"), но нажатие возврата не ведет себя так, как ожидалось. Вместо запуска команды, приглашение просто переходит на следующую строку.

Я рассказал своему другу об этой команде (М-! matlab), он пытался, и он работал на его компьютере (Mac и Aquamacs, как и я), то есть теперь он может использовать Matlab из Emacs.

Почему это не работает на моем компьютере? У меня какая-то опция отключена или как?

1 ответ1

3

Я предполагаю, что вы используете концы линий в стиле DOS, но вам нужны концы в стиле Mac. Попробуйте изменить его, используя Mx RET p

Проект интеграции MATLAB / Emacs может быть лучшим способом запуска MATLAB внутри Emacs.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.